  • Patent number: 10571989
    Abstract: A data collection system includes one or more input sensing devices and a data collection device. The data collection device includes data collection circuitry that is continuously activated to capture measurement data samples from the one or more input sensing devices and locally store the measurement data samples. The data collection device also includes a digital processor that is coupled to the data collection circuitry and is activated to locally perform a sample analysis of the measurement data samples, wherein the sample analysis is a regular analysis of routine measurement data samples when the measurement data samples are without a triggering event, and wherein the sample analysis is an event analysis when the measurement data samples include a triggering event. A data collection integrated circuit and a measurement data sample collection method are also included.
    Type: Grant
    Filed: September 7, 2017
    Date of Patent: February 25, 2020
    Assignees: VeriSilicon Microelectronics (Shanghai) Co., Ltd., VeriSilicon Holdings Co., Ltd.
    Inventors: Seshagiri Prasad Kalluri, Vijayanand Angarai, Adam Christopher Krolnik, Venkata Krishna Vemireddy

  • Patent number: 9538285
    Abstract: A microphone array processing system and method carried out in the system. In one embodiment, the system includes: (1) a beamformer configured to perform adaptive beamforming on gain-compensated signals received from a plurality of microphones, the adaptive beamforming including dynamic range compression and diagonal loading of a sample correlation matrix based on order statistics and (2) a postfilter configured to receive an output of the beamformer and reduce noise components remaining from the beamforming.
    Type: Grant
    Filed: June 22, 2012
    Date of Patent: January 3, 2017
    Assignee: VERISILICON HOLDINGS CO., LTD.
    Inventors: Jitendra D. Rayala, Krishna Vemireddy

  • Publication number: 20130343549
    Abstract: A system and method for generating multiple audio channels. In one embodiment, the system includes: (1) an array of omnidirectional microphones and (2) a beamformer coupled to the array and operable to transform signals produced by the array into multiple directional audio channels.
    Type: Application
    Filed: July 1, 2013
    Publication date: December 26, 2013
    Inventors: Krishna Vemireddy, Jitendra D. Rayala
